Bethesda has announced that the Fallout 4 1.5 update is now available for download via Steam. This will bring the Survival Mode out of beta for PC gamers. If you are on consoles, you don’t need to worry since you will not be waiting too long for this mode.
That is because Bethesda has confirmed that the Fallout 4 Survival Mode for PlayStation 4 and Xbox One is going to arrive next week, so your wait is almost over.
The new version of Survival Mode, Fallout 4’s highest difficulty setting, is the biggest feature in this update. It was launched as a beta last month, allowing beta testers to try out the new version, which includes limits on fast travel among other challenges and obstacles. If you want a challenge this is the mode you want to try.
Fallout 4’s latest update also comes with some bug fixes, and sets the stage for the upcoming Far Harbor expansion, the DLC is going to be released for PC and console gamers later this spring. We don’t have a precise date yet. Bethesda has confirmed today that this update is going to land on PlayStation 4 and Xbox One next week. Fallout 4 mods will also be arriving on consoles starting next month, the tools go live for Xbox One next month and for PlayStation 4 in June. Fallout fans should be happy.
